设置网站的SSL证书是确保网络安全的重要步骤,需要在网站服务器上安装和配置SSL证书,选择合适的加密算法和密钥长度,确保数据传输的安全性,将SSL证书与网站域名关联,确保用户访问时能正确识别并使用安全的连接,更新网站的页面、菜单和链接的URL为HTTPS,避免混淆,为用户提供更好的访问体验,并通过SSL检查工具定期检查网站安全性。
在数字化时代,网站的安全性成为了企业和个人必须面对的重要问题,信息安全传输的关键手段之一就是使用SSL证书,本文将为您详细解析如何为网站设置SSL证书,以确保您的网站能够安全、稳定地运行。
什么是SSL证书?
SSL(Secure Socket Layer)证书,即安全套接层证书,是一种用于加强网络通信安全性的技术,它通过对传输的数据进行加密,确保用户数据在传输过程中不被第三方窃取或篡改,SSL证书还能验证网站的身份,防止用户访问假冒的网站。
为什么需要SSL证书?
-
数据加密:保护用户隐私和敏感信息不被泄露。
-
身份验证:确认网站的身份,防止用户被欺诈。
-
建立信任:提高用户对网站的信任度,促进业务发展。
如何申请SSL证书?
您可以选择从权威的证书颁发机构(CA)申请SSL证书,如Let's Encrypt、DigiCert、GlobalSign等,申请时,需提供网站的相关信息,如域名所有权证明、网站负责人信息等,申请成功后,CA将为您签发SSL证书。
如何安装SSL证书?
安装SSL证书分为两个主要步骤:获取证书和配置服务器。
-
获取证书:如果您通过浏览器自动获取证书,则无需额外操作,若需手动安装,请下载证书文件(通常为CRT、PEM或KEY格式),并导入到服务器的SSL配置中。
-
配置服务器:根据您使用的服务器类型(如Apache、Nginx等),编辑相应的配置文件,添加SSL证书文件路径,并启用HTTPS服务,对于Apache,可以在配置文件中添加以下代码:
SSLCertificateFile /path/to/your/certificate.crt SSLCertificateKeyFile /path/to/your/private.key
对于Nginx,可以添加以下代码:
ssl_certificate /path/to/your/certificate.crt; ssl_certificate_key /path/to/your/private.key;
配置完成后,重启服务器以使更改生效。
安装SSL证书后的注意事项
-
测试连接:使用SSL测试工具(如SSL Labs的SSL Server Test)检查您的网站是否正确安装了SSL证书。
-
更新证书:定期更新SSL证书以防止过期。
-
监控安全性:保持对网络安全状况的关注,及时应对潜在的安全威胁。
设置网站的SSL证书是保障网站安全性的重要步骤,通过本文的介绍,相信您已经了解了如何为网站申请、安装和管理SSL证书,让我们共同努力,为您的网站构建一个安全、可靠的网络环境!